Some of you may have had some trouble accessing the eShop today, and having assumed it was the usual short weekly session we decided to wait a short while. Then we waited a little longer.

In actual fact, the eShop will likely be down for most of 2nd November due to a potential 24-hour maintenance window; naturally Nintendo may finish its work quicker than that. It's only the eShop platforms and the equivalent download stores on Wii and DS that are down for that extended period, with the maintenance due to end at 7pm Pacific / 10pm Eastern on 2nd November, which is 3am UK / 4am CET on 3rd November for Europeans.

Before you get too excited, though, the following tweet from Nintendo's Japanese account has indicated this is a major server change, so won't necessarily lead to anything tangible and exciting for gamers.
